从机任务应该随时都能检测到间隔/同步信号序列。如果从机任务正在接收数据场的字节时检测到间隔/同步信号序列,假设此时各个字节数据之间是相互分开的,那么从机任务应该放弃当前进行的数据传输,重新开始处理新的报文帧。 标识符由6位组成,取值范围是0-63;标识符类型分为四种: 0-59用于信号传输的报文帧 60,61用于传送诊断数据 62保留给用户定义的扩展帧 63保留给协议扩展 校验和是数据场所有字节的和的反码或者是数据场所有字节和标识符场的和的反码,取一个字节。 字节之间最大的延时时间是额定传输时间的40%,这些额外的时间可以分摊到报头和响应帧。因此,最大帧长度…….. 按照传输报文帧的不同状况将报文帧分为以下几种类型,网络上的各个节点并不需要支持全部的报文帧类型。 在少数情况下,由于没有足够的总线带宽,多个从机节点的通信会造成总线资源紧张。为了提高此时LIN网络的响应能力,LIN规范定义了事件触发帧。 事件触发帧传输一个或多个无条件帧的数据场,它的标识符范围是0-59.被传送的无条件帧的第一个字节必须等于它的ID,即这个帧最多只能传输7个字节的信号消息。 如果一个事件触发帧和多个无条件帧相关联(正常情况下),那么这些报文帧都应该有相同的长度,使用相同的校验和形式,并且应该分别由不同的从机任务响应发送。 当开始传输事件触发帧的时候,先发送报头,如果与这个事件触发帧相关联的无条件帧中有信号被更新,那么从机才对报头发送响应帧。如果没有从机任务响应这个触发帧帧头,这个帧头就会被总线忽略,这帧剩余的传输时间内总线上会没有数据信号。如果有多个从机任务对帧头发出响应,那么就会产生总线冲突。这时,主机必须通过对所有相关联的无条件帧逐一发出请求来解决冲突,然后才能再次请求发送事件触发帧。 事件触发帧典型的使用例子是在一个四车门中央门锁系统中监控各个车门锁。系统通过事件触发帧去查询四个门锁的状态,响应时间更短,同时还减轻了总线的工作负载。即使在极少数的情况下多个乘客同时按下不同的车门锁,系统也不会错过任何一个按键,只是会多花一点时间处理而已。 在LIN的协议里,有些调度表主要是用来处理确定性事件和实时事件的,为了使这些调度表不和一些随机事件发生冲突,保证整个进度表的确定性,因此使用了偶发帧。 偶发帧只发送信号消息,标识符0-59 偶发帧由一组无条件帧组成,这些无条件帧共享相同的帧时隙 当主机任务知道有新的信号消息时,就会在分配给零星帧的时段里发送帧头信号,零星帧发布者将对帧头发送响应帧。接收者接收报文帧并进行校验,通过后使用这帧数据。 若有多个零星帧被分配在同一个报文帧时段里传输,则将传输优先级最高的零星帧。 若在分配给零星帧的时段里,所有零星帧都没有新的信号更新,则这个时段将没有信号在总线上传输。因为通常情况下,主机任务都会知道有新的信号被更新,所以主机节点一般都是零星帧的发布者。 在发送诊断帧的帧头之前,主机任务先查询自己的诊断模块是否需要发送诊断帧,从机任务根据各自的诊断模块发送和接收随后的响应帧。 时基在主节点里实现,通常取值是5-10ms 从机任务的工作是:当它作为发布者(Publisher)时,发送响应帧;当它作为接收者(Subscriber)时,接收响应帧。从机任务的模型包含两个状态机: 间隔场和同步场监测器 帧处理器、 间隔场和同步场监测器 从机任务必须在接收报文帧的PID场之前完成同步,也就是说,它必须正确地接收PID场。在剩余的报文帧传输时间内,从级任务必须在规定的位速率容差范围内保持同步状态。为此,每一个报文帧都必须以间隔场在前、同步产个在后的顺序开始。这种顺序在真个LIN通信中是统一的,并且为从机任务提供了足够的信息去检测一个新的报文帧的开始,并在标识符场发送前完成同步。 处理器 帧处理器包含两种状态:待机状态和工作状态。工作状态又包含五个子状态。一旦检测到间隔场和同步场信号,帧处理器就会进入工作状态的接收标识符子状态,这意味着如果检测到一个新的间隔场和同步场信号序列,帧处理器就会放弃当前帧的处理,准备接收新的报文帧。
您可能关注的文档
- 2015人版八年级英语(上册)unit5复习课件.ppt
- 2016年全国高考政治试题经济生活分类(附答案解析).doc
- 2016年市级企业技术中心申报材料___转Word(30050).doc
- 2017高考物理考纲解读和一轮复习建议.ppt
- 2018《教育综合知识》模拟试卷(四).doc
- 2018年九年级历史(上册)第18课美国的独立.ppt
- 2018年上半年我国化工行业经营情况和未来发展前景图文分析报告文案.doc
- 2019扁平化红色喜庆工作计划总结PPT模板.ppt
- 2019部编四年级语文(下册)期末试卷(共四套,附答案).doc
- 2019创意复古商务工作计划总结通用PPT模板.ppt
- 宣贯培训(2026年)GBT 38187-2019《汽车电气电子可靠性术语》.pptx
- 宣贯培训(2026年)GBT 38180-2019《微型燃气轮机应用 安全》深度解读.pptx
- 痔疮的科普知识PPT课件.pptx
- 痔疮的科普知识PPT课件.pptx
- 宣贯培训(2026年)GBT 38196-2019《建筑施工机械与设备 地面切割机 安全要求》.pptx
- 宣贯培训(2026年)GBT 38174-2019《风能发电系统 风力发电场可利用率》.pptx
- 宣贯培训(2026年)GBT 38197-2019《建筑施工机械绿色性能指标与评价方法》.pptx
- 第3课+“开元盛世”与唐朝经济的繁荣【课件】-【课堂赋能】2025-2026学年七年级历史下册同步教学(统编版新教材).pptx
- 宣贯培训(2026年)GBT 38200-2019《太阳电池量子效率测试方法》.pptx
- 宣贯培训(2026年)GBT 38214-2019中空玻璃惰性气体含量测试方法.pptx
原创力文档

文档评论(0)